AI Technical Summary
Existing red phosphors used in white LEDs have issues such as low red sensitivity, decreased lumen equivalent, and poor color rendering properties due to their long emission peak wavelength and wide half-value width, necessitating a more environmentally friendly and efficient alternative.
A novel red phosphor with a specific crystal phase composition, represented by Re x (Sr 1-y MA y ) a MB b MC c N d O e X f , where MA, MB, MC, and X are specific elements, and the phosphor exhibits a peak wavelength between 620 nm and 645 nm with a full width at half maximum (FWHM) of 70 nm or less, enhancing emission efficiency and color rendering.
The novel red phosphor provides improved emission color, increased red sensitivity, and enhanced color rendering properties, leading to better luminescence efficiency and color reproduction in lighting and display devices.
